MT-32 with revision 0 PCB, used in units up to serial number 851399.
The PGA LA32 chip is later replaced with a 100-pin QFP type.

How games sound (in terms of the quality of the samples, vibrato effect, etc.), I would say no.
How the different revisions of the MT-32 modules behave, that will vary depending on what PCB revision and control ROM version you have (the latter being of more importance).
